Site Environmental Monitoring. <br /> (01) I On-site Groundwater. The Licensee shall perform on-site water quality <br /> testing at the monitoring wells in the manner required by the MPCA permit. The <br /> wells I shall meet current Department of Health Well Code Standards. The Water <br /> Qualilty report shall be submitted to the City when it is submitted to the MPCA. <br /> (02) Surface Water Quality. The Licensee shall have surface water quality tests <br /> performed in conjunction with sampling quarterly events when water is present. <br /> (03) Off-Site Groundwater Quality. The Licensee shall annually sample the III <br /> indivi ual private wells identified in the Comprehensive Monitoring Plan Phase <br /> IV ter Quality Monitoring Work Plan required by Section 4(05). All private <br /> wells hall be analyzed for pH, COD, ammonia, chlorides, specific conductance, <br /> and v latile organic compounds (MDH method 465C and EPA method 601, 602). <br /> (04) Modification. The testing programs specified in this Section 6 may be <br /> • modi ed by City staff if City staff reasonably determines there exists a need for <br /> additi nal wells to be tested or additional parameters to be analyzed, based upon <br /> water r air quality test results indicating the presence of contamination. <br /> 8.) Hydrogeologic Reports. The investigation of the hydrological and <br /> geoph sical characteristics of the site shall be continued and any other new <br /> info ation relating to the hydrogerlogic impact of the site shall be reported to the <br /> City. Hydrogeologic reports shall be updated, amended, and modified as <br /> warranted by newly discovered or additional data acquired in the continued <br /> hydro eologic investigation. Licensee shall notify City at least two (2) days in <br /> advan e of any soil boring or well construction required by this License. <br /> 9.) Dust,Noise, and Odor.
